Firefox trying to login to OLD account when I enter CURRENT one

more options

I just fired up a computer I have not used in like 6 months.

I tried to login to my CURRENT Firefox account which I use with 3 devices.

I go through the email + password + verification process but when I finally enter the verification code (sent to the RIGHT email address) Firefox says "wrong password" and shows an OLD email I used to use.

I changed this email twice at least in the past 1+ years so I am not sure what's happening.

In case of issues with Sync you can try this:

Disconnect from Sync and Reconnect to Sync again. You can disconnect from Sync by clicking the e-mail address in the "3-bar" Firefox menu button drop-down list or go to "Options/Preferences -> Sync".

Delete the signedInUser.json file in the Firefox profile folder and delete the Weave folder (Sync was formerly named Weave) with Firefox closed.

Remove an existing chrome://FirefoxAccounts entry in the Firefox Password Manager.

If that isn't enough then delete the prefs.js files to reset all prefs and maybe also delete the compatibility.ini file.

You can use the button on the "Help -> More Troubleshooting Information" (about:support) page to go to the current Firefox profile folder or use the about:profiles page.


If that still fails then try to create a new profile.

You can create a new profile as a quick test to see if your current profile is causing the problem.

See "Creating a profile":

If the new profile works then you can transfer files from a previously used profile to the new profile, but be cautious not to copy corrupted files to avoid carrying over problems.

Before seeking for help, I used the Windows popup tool to delete the only profile I saw before creating a new one.

However, this solution did not work UNTIL I physically went to the profiles folder and deleted ALL old profiles that were still there.
